The Victorian Government has approved plans to redevelop Mornington’s Alexandra Park Pavilion, clearing the way for the creation of a new co-located medical and sporting facility.

Approval of Mornington Peninsula Planning Scheme Amendment C263morn means we can now get on with delivering this much-anticipated community asset, in partnership with the Alexandra Park Project Group and The Bays Hospital.

The project will see two old, outdated sports pavilions replaced with one double-storey building covering a similar footprint. When complete, it will provide the four sporting clubs that call Alexandra Park home with modern clubrooms and facilities suited to the needs of all players, officials and spectators.

The new building will also give our community access to medical specialist consulting services, as well as community-focussed health and wellbeing programs.

The Alexandra Park Project Group has committed significant time, energy and resources to getting this project off the ground, including raising $400,000 in community funding.

In 2019, Flinders Federal MP Greg Hunt secured $2.6 million in Federal funding and AFL Victoria has provided a further $100,000. Council has committed to providing the remaining funding to ensure this project goes ahead.
